Predictable Revenue Streams

When you open an independent restaurant, there’s always uncertainty. Will customers show up? Will your menu hit the mark? How long before you make a profit?

Franchises address many of these problems by offering built-in demand and proven operational systems. With the right brand, you’re likely to generate consistent, predictable income from day one. Here’s how franchise revenue is more stable:

  • Established customer base with built-in brand loyalty.
  • Consistent menu and pricing mean more accurate financial forecasting.
  • National or regional advertising helps drive traffic to your location..

Proven Business Models

Starting from scratch is risky. You have to test marketing strategies, refine your menu, and build your team — all through trial and error. Franchises eliminate much of that uncertainty by offering a tested business model.

When you buy a fast food franchise, you're not just getting a logo and a name. You’re buying a fully developed playbook. This usually includes:

  • Training programs for owners and staff.
  • Operational guides, systems, and software to run the business.
  • Centralized supply chains and vendor relationships.

Easier Access to Financing

Banks and investors love predictability — and that’s what franchising offers. Lenders are often more comfortable funding a franchise business because it has lower failure rates compared to independent ventures. With a franchise, you’re more likely to:

  • Secure SBA loans and traditional financing.
  • Get favorable interest rates due to brand stability.
  • Access funding partners recommended by the franchisor.

Streamlined Marketing and Support

Effective marketing is time-consuming and expensive. But fast food franchises offer a huge advantage: built-in marketing strategies, materials, and brand recognition. Franchisees typically benefit from:

  • National advertising campaigns across TV, radio, and online platforms.
  • Local marketing playbooks to help attract nearby customers.
  • Branded materials, social media content, and seasonal promotions.

This marketing power not only saves you time and money, but it also delivers real traffic to your location.
